Understanding the 70th Week–The Tribulation Period

Nothing in the Bible elicits as much excited interest as well as stupefied perplexity as the Tribulation Period in prophecy. Honest questions arise as to how long it is. Is it 3 1/2 years or seven years. And just what will happen during that time?

Answers begin to emerge from comprehending the number “seventy.” Daniel “understood by books the number ” 70. He gained this grace from God in the first year of Darius the Mede in about 538 B.C. (Dan 9: 2). One of the books he studied was II Chronicles 36, which told of the Babylonian desecration of Jerusalem and its temple and the captivity of its people. This was allowed by God, for they had not repented of their sins against Yahweh (v. 16-20). This fulfilled the word of Yahweh through Jeremiah. “For as long as she lay desolate she kept sabbath, to fulfill threescore and ten years” (v. 21).

70 years. Important number that God would shed more light on to His prophet Daniel. For the great revelation that Daniel received was not that they would be in captivity for 70 years. That was given in v. 21 above. The revelation that he received from God was the significance placed on the number “70” not just the seventy years.

For the number 70 represented 70 weeks of years–a total of 490 years that would play a prominent role in establishing several milestones in the completion of the plan of God in bringing His literal kingdom to this earth. This is the “stone kingdom” that Daniel saw earlier (Dan. 2: 44-45).

There would be seventy “seven-year-periods” or seventy weeks-of-years that would assume supreme importance in God’s plan.
Gabriel himself came to the seeking prophet Daniel to expound the milestones leading up to His kingdom coming to earth. “Seventy weeks are determined upon thy people and upon thy holy city” to accomplish several things that Christ accomplished in His first coming (v. 24). This was done using 69 of the 70 seven-year periods (v. 25).

Then the remaining “one week” is mentioned in verse 27. During the time of the 70th week of years, a “prince…shall come and shall destroy the city and the sanctuary” (v. 26). This wicked ruler “shall confirm the covenant with many for one week” (v. 27). This is the remaining “one week of years” or a seven year period. Of course, the wicked prince is universally believed to be the Anti-Christ or the “man of sin.”

But the question arises. Which seven year period is it? And when will it take place? The answer is a key point in unlocking the mystery of when Christ sets up His kingdom here on earth and the milieu upon its arrival. “In the midst of the week he shall cause the sacrifice and oblation to cease…and he shall make it desolate” (v. 27). All the key words–sacrifice, oblation to cease, abominations, desolate–point to a specific seven year period in scripture. And all of this happens “even until the consummation.” The word translated “consummation” is translated in other passages as “full end” and “utter end.” Sounds like the “time of the end” to me.

Christ confirms this time frame by quoting Dan. 9 in Matt. 24: 15. When this desecration, this abomination happens in the rebuilt temple, it will mark the “midst of the week,” the last half of the last of the seven-year-periods of the seventy weeks-of-years spoken of by the prophets.

It is generally believed by many that the tribulation in the form of the seven trumpets in Rev. 8 comprises the first 3 1/2 years. Much destruction worldwide ensues during this time. But the last half, the seven vials of wrath, is the “great tribulation” spoken of.

Origins of Christmas Season Found in “MYSTERY, BABYLON THE GREAT”

“MYSTERY, BABYLON THE GREAT” is referred to as the woman, which is a symbol of a false religious system.  This mother church system has an identifier in the scriptures.  This is a tag that tells us about her.  She has a “name written in her forehead.”  Names in scripture tell what the person or thing is—what its roots are, what its core values are.  A name in scripture tells us its origin, its reason to be, and its destiny.  This name written in her forehead means that her mind is full of what her name implies.  Her heart and mind is full of what her name means. And her name was “MYSTERY, BABYLON THE GREAT, THE MOTHER OF HARLOTS AND ABOMINATIONS OF THE EARTH” (Rev. 17:5).  Her name is given all in capital letters to signify its great importance to us.

First, this church’s name is a “MYSTERY.”  The masses who wonder after the world system are in the dark.  The origin of the political and religious systems of the earth is a mystery to them.  A mystery is a “who done it?”  The passive masses are in the dark about the characters and their roles in the drama happening on the world stage.

The second part of her name is “BABYLON THE GREAT.”  This term is a mystery also.  The first thing that comes to mind is the ancient city of Babylon, the capital of the Babylonian Empire in what is today Iraq.  This great city, described by the Greek historian Herodotus, was so grand in its day that its Hanging Gardens was known as one of the Seven Wonders of the Ancient World.

But what’s the old city of Babylon’s connection to the name of the woman riding the beast in Revelation 17:5? Why is this old city’s name a part of the name of the false religious system that persecutes the true followers in the last days?

The answer lies in the fact that the religious system of the ancient city of Babylon has passed itself on down through the centuries to our day.  History teaches us that the Near East’s fertile crescent spawned a mystery religion with its birthplace in Babylon.  It was there that Nimrod became prominent.  He was the son of Cush, the grandson of Ham, and the great grandson of Noah.  “He began to be a mighty one in the earth.  “He was a mighty hunter before YHWH: wherefore it is said, Even as Nimrod the mighty hunter before YHWH.  And the beginning of his kingdom was Babel {Gr. Babylon}” (Genesis 10: 8-10).  This religion was passed on down to pagan Rome.  {Even the Catholic Bible admits in a footnote on Rev. 17: 5 that “MYSTERY, BABYLON THE GREAT” is pagan Rome!  Read it here http://www.newadvent.org/bible/rev017.htm }

And one of these ancient pagan traditions that not only has survived, but has thrived today is Christmas.  People all over the world celebrate this holiday, not knowing of its tainted origin and of its pagan roots.

This brings us to the whorish woman’s name: “MOTHER OF HARLOTS AND ABOMINATIONS OF THE EARTH.”  This false church is a mother church.  Who did she give birth to?  The law of harvest states, Each seed bears its own kind.  Those organizations who practice and adhere to the mother’s doctrines and traditions are by nature her offspring—daughters of the mother church. And one of pagan Babylon’s strongest traditions is the winter solstice season’s Saturnalia/Christmas.  And yet, the whole world wonders after it, believing that it is the greatest time of year, not know at what they marvel.

“The Day of the LORD” (YAHWEH)–The Fall of Mystery, Babylon the Great

Endtime Prophecy on Mystery, Babylon the Great

The “day of the LORD” (Yahweh) is a day not to wish for.  It brings desolation, cosmic collisions with the earth, utter upheaval and destruction of man’s status quo.  Suffering, “pangs and sorrows…pain” fills the faces of mankind.  It is “cruel both with wrath and fierce anger, to lay the land desolate: and he shall destroy the sinners thereof out of it” (Isaiah 13: 1-10).

Many will stop here and claim that this prophecy written in 713 B.C. was fulfilled when the Babylonian Kingdom would fall many years later.  It was on one level, but the prophecy has a deeper, more far reaching force that takes those ominous words and thrusts them into our modern day scene.  These inspired words of Yahweh through the prophet Isaiah take on a universal worldwide scope when God warns in the very next breath: “And I will punish the world for their evil, and the wicked for their iniquity…” (v. 11).

God goes cosmic in vision and scope while at the same time outlining the demise of  the ancient Babylonian Empire.

For the Babylon of old is a symbol of the one world system of false religion, government, and education.  The prophet Daniel in chapter 2 speaks of the Babylonian Empire as the head of gold of a much larger all-encompassing beast image.  All Bible scholars concede that the great image that Nebuchadnezzar dreamed was a glimpse into the future of four great world Gentile governments.  These would rule the earth in successive waves from c. 600 B.C. to our present day.

Nebuchadnezzar forgot the dream, much less the interpretation.  Contained in the dream was a secret from the Almighty.  “Then was the secret revealed unto Daniel in a night vision.  Then Daniel blessed the God of heaven” (v. 19).  Daniel proclaimed before the king that God “reveals the deep and secret things: He knows what is in the darkness…” (v. 22).  Daniel goes on to say that the wise men of Babylon cannot reveal the secret of the dream, “but there is a God in heaven that reveals secrets, and makes known to the king Nebuchadnezzar what shall be in the latter days” (v. 28).

The God in heaven “reveals secrets.”  And what are these secrets?  The Spirit in Daniel says it another way in the very next breath.  Revealing secrets is the same as making known now what will happen in the future– “in the latter days,” the time of the end.  The time when the “day of the LORD (Yahweh)” comes.  The time when God “will punish the world for their evil.”  That is the time we are living in.

This passage in Daniel is profound and rich with meaning for us.  The religious wise men of ancient Babylon, of the world system of their day, could not reveal the secret to the king.  They prided themselves as fortune tellers and soothsayers predicting future events, but they could not really see into the future to our dayThey were “blind, leaders of the blind,” not knowing the extent of their parts in the false worship system.  The secret of what will happen in our latter day era was not revealed to them, for God withheld it from them.  They did not know that the secret of Nebuchadnezzar’s dream is an astounding prophecy that takes us to the very latter days of end time happenings.

The dream, of course, was that of a “great image…whose brightness was excellent…and the form was terrible” (2: 31).  First, it was an image.  It was not the real deal.  The people were in awe of it, for it was bright and excellent.  It had a head of gold, breast and arms of silver, belly and thighs of brass, and legs of iron with feet of both iron and clay.  Then he saw a stone from heaven crash into the feet of the image and destroy it.  And the stone “became a great mountain and filled the whole earth.

Daniel by God’s Spirit interprets the image as four world empires, beginning with Babylon.  It is universally recognized that they are Babylon, Media-Persia, Greece, and Rome.  The last kingdom that smashed them down is the kingdom of God, and “it shall stand forever” (v. 44).

Daniel told the king of Babylon Nebuchadnezzar, “You are this head of gold.”  The head of any body contains the brain, the thoughts, which dictates the actions of that body.  The thoughts of the head resonate on down through the ensuing kingdoms.  The Babylonian religions were the Eastern Mystery Religions that would permeate the West, finally lodging securely in Rome [for much more see The Two Babylons by Hislop here: http://www.biblebelievers.com/babylon/ ].  These mystery religions flourished so much that they became the very source of papal catholic worship to this day.

This is why the apostle John saw in Revelation that the world religious system at the time of the end would be called an evil woman, “a great whore that sits upon many waters: with whom the kings of the earth have committed fornication…”  And the woman sat on “a scarlet colored beast…and upon her forehead was a name written, MYSTERY, BABYLON THE GREAT, THE MOTHER OF HARLOTS AND ABOMINATIONS OF THE EARTH” (Rev. 17: 5).  “An the woman which you saw is that great city, which reigns over the kings of the earth” (v. 18).  And that city is Rome.  And those teachings out of Rome have come down to modern man through the mother Catholic church and her protestant daughters.  I does say that Babylon the Great is the mother of harlots and abominations.
